After thinking on it for a month and checking different combinations of factors, I think what really happened was my boot got stuck because my foot's arch was on the pegs instead of my toes.
Reason for that is I had just slipped my foot forward to downshift, then immediately came to a stop. My work-around is move my foot forward to downshift to first, slide my foot back to having my toes on the pegs, then come to a completely stop then take my foot off.
And I'd rather have taken that spill at 0 and learn how to work with protective boots than going down on the freeway and break these tiny little bones in my feet at speed, tell you the truth.
